#98cbf9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#98cbf9 is composed of 59.6% red, 79.6%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39% cyan, 18.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 208.5 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 78.6%. #98cbf9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3197f3.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

Shades and Tints of #98cbf9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000508 is the darkest color, while #f5f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#98cbf9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c6c9cb is the less saturated color, while #94cbfd is the most saturated one.
